> * Move the hwclock.sh initscript from busybox into its own package and
>   recipe (hwclock-init). This script is generally useful for distros
>   that get their hwclock implementation from sources other than
>   busybox (like util-linux).
>
> :busybox/*
> * Remove the busybox-hwclock package, as it no longer has a purpose.
> * If busybox is configured to include hwclock, the busybox package will
>   RDEPEND on hwclock-init.
>
> :util-linux/*
> * util-linux-hwclock RDEPENDS on hwclock-init for its initscript.
